Neural Assimilation and Accommodation in Trilinguals: An fMRI Study at 7 T

open access: yesHuman Brain Mapping, Volume 47, Issue 11, 01 August 2026.
Using brain activation and representational similarity analysis at 7 T‐MRI, this study demonstrated that the trilingual brain flexibly modulated neural assimilation and accommodation. While Chinese and English shared highly similar neural representations, Japanese engaged distinct patterns, highlighting script‐driven effects on multilingual neural ...

Single‐Breathhold 3D MR Elastography in the Liver, With Simultaneous R2* and PDFF Mapping

open access: yesMagnetic Resonance in Medicine, Volume 96, Issue 2, Page 682-697, August 2026.
Purpose To develop a sequence for the rapid acquisition of MR elastography (MRE) parameters in 3D, with simultaneous measurement of proton‐density fat fraction (PDFF) and R2* for multiparametric assessment of liver disease.
